What is latency and how to keep it within seconds
Latency is the time between a request and the model's answer: it is broken into its parts, each part is measured, and the user's wait is brought down to seconds.

Context bloat: what it means in plain terms
Context bloat is the growth in the volume of text sent to the model with every request, without any growth in the value that text delivers.

What is context compaction and why long sessions need it
Context compaction replaces a bloated conversation history with a short summary: the work continues, but the input volume of each turn stops growing.

What Is a Token and Why You Pay for It
A token is a chunk of text roughly three quarters of a word long: the model reads a request in tokens, and the provider bills for how many there are.
